“BOTTEGA VENETA” 2010’s Tassel leather loafers
As a master of understated yet assuredly luxurious leather goods, BOTTEGA VENETA has consistently balanced beauty and practicality at a high level. Here, we present a quietly distinctive piece that embodies subtle individuality at your feet.
This exquisite item cleverly replaces the brand’s signature weaving concept with a subdued embossing technique, showcasing an intelligent playfulness.
Overall, the design is based on a classic loafer structure, with a finely embossed diamond pattern on the upper leather. From a distance, it maintains a neat and composed appearance, while up close, delicate shading on the surface reveals a meticulous attention to material, characteristic of BOTTEGA VENETA. The subtle embossing, which could have been a bold woven pattern, quietly expresses sophistication, making this piece uniquely refined.
Furthermore, a white leather panel is layered over the vamp, with a knotted tassel decoration at the center, adding a touch of lightness and tradition typical of loafers. This decoration is not merely ornamental; it also adds three-dimensionality to the smooth, curved upper surface, preventing the front view from appearing flat and maintaining a balanced charm within its refined appearance.
The contrast between beige and white is also exceptionally well executed. Instead of creating a stark color contrast, it maintains a gentle difference, ensuring it doesn’t stand out too much when incorporated into an outfit, yet leaves a proper impression at the feet. Additionally, the rounded shape of the last is not overly slim, avoiding the tension often associated with classic loafers, and instead evokes a sense of softness that naturally invites everyday wear.
What’s particularly notable is the sole design: a rubber sole with wave-patterned grooves paired with a refined leather upper. This combination ensures practicality without sacrificing visual elegance, directly contributing to stability when walking and ease of handling in urban life. Despite being a dress shoe, it can be worn casually without feeling out of place, reflecting BOTTEGA VENETA’s philosophy during Thomas Mayer’s era of prioritizing luxury that enhances daily life rather than just standing out.
Regarding the era, it is natural to consider it as a piece from around 2010 to 2017, since the logo on the insole uses the traditional serif font, making it unlikely to be from after the 2018 rebranding. Furthermore, the balanced foil stamping, the design combining embossed leather with practical rubber soles, and the overall aesthetic align with the comfort and quality typical of BOTTEGA VENETA in the 2010s, lending credibility to the estimated period.
